Jadzia Dax / dʒædˈziːə ˈdæks /, played by Terry Farrell, is a fictional character from the science-fiction television series Star Trek: Deep Space Nine . Jadzia Dax is a joined Trill. Though she appears to be a young woman, Jadzia lives in symbiosis with a long-lived creature, known as a symbiont, named Dax; Jadzia is Dax's eighth host.

Henry Silva (September 23, 1926 – September 14, 2022) was an American actor, with a film and television career which spanned fifty years. A prolific character actor in over 140 productions, he was known for his “dark, sepulchral” [1] looks and brooding screen presence that saw him often play criminals, gangsters, or other “tough guys” in crime and action films.
